离散数学中关系概念教学探析:从具体归纳到抽象概念.docVIP

离散数学中关系概念教学探析:从具体归纳到抽象概念.doc

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
离散数学中关系概念教学探析:从具体归纳到抽象概念

离散数学中关系概念教学探析:从具体归纳到抽象概念  离散数学中关系概念的教学探讨:从具体归纳到抽象概念 论文代写   离散数学是信息学科尤其是计算机学科的一门重要的专业基础课程,它的主要研究对象是离散结构及其应用,为计算机理论和应用提供必不可少的数学基础及思维方法。其理论和方法大量地应用在数字电路、编译原理、数据结构、操作系统、数据库系统、算法的分析与设计、人工智能、计算机网络等专业课程中,同时也为计算机应用提供必要的数学工具。  然而,该学科的知识点分散、概念抽象,给学生学习和理解带来很大困难。如何学好这门课,对计算机学科的学生来说显得特别重要;如何教好离散数学,从而提高教学质量,是有关教师应该努力探讨和研究的。  本文主要探讨离散数学中关系的教学方法,期望对类似的问题能有参考意义。  1 关系的重要性  关系是离散数学中用来刻画事物之间联系的一个重要的概念,在计算机科学与技术领域中有着广泛的应用。关系数据库模型就是以关系及其运算作为理论基础的[1]。图论中的一个图,实际上也就是相关对象集合上的一个关系。正确理解关系的概念以及关系模型,对于利用关系模型来进行数学建模尤其重要。  2 关系的定义及集合表示  定义1:(二元关系)假设A和B是两个集合,A与B的笛卡尔积Atimes;B的一个子集合,叫做一个A到B的二元关系[2]。  定义2:(多元关系)假设A1,A2,hellip;An是n个集合,它们的笛卡尔积A1times;A2times;hellip;times;An的一个子集合,叫做一个A1,A2,hellip;An间的一个n元关系[3]。  以上的两个定义分别是二元关系和多元关系的定义,但无论是哪个定义,都似乎跟实际中的关系有很大距离,学生很难想象如何将实际中的关系跟这些个抽象的定义联系起来,他们必然要问:为什么要这样定义关系?  现实中的关系一般指事物之间或者对象之间的某种或者某些联系,这些对象之间的关系,也同样可以说是集合的元素之间的关系,以下是一些实际关系的例子。  【例1】四支球队a、b、c及d队,他们之间进行了一些比赛,以下一张表格记录了他们之间的比赛结果”“胜负关系:a胜b、b胜c、c胜a、d胜a、d胜b、d又胜了c。为了简单起见,用(a,b)来表示a胜b,于是可以将所有胜负重新记录表示成{(a,b),(b,c),(c,a),(d,a),(d,b),(d,c),(d,b)}。这就是一张胜负表,该表清楚地表现了这四个队a、b、c、d之间的胜负关系,它就是这四个队之间的一个关系”“比赛胜负关系。  当用集合S表示4个队时,S={a,b,c,d},那么胜负关系表{(a,b),(b,c),(c,a),(d,a),(d,b),(d,c),(d,b)}就是S与S的笛卡尔积Stimes;S的一个子集。也就是说用这个子集合表示了这四个队之间的某轮比赛的胜负关系。  【例2】一个电话号码簿,它里面记录了很多单位或个人的一些电话号码。不难理解,一个号码本就是一个集合。这个号码本也就是这个集合表示了人和单位跟一些电话号码之间的一种关系,它是一个实实在在的关系。如果用A表示所有有关的单位和人的集合,用B表示所有相关的电话号码的集合,简单地用(a,b)表示a的电话号码是b,其中aisin;A,bisin;B分别表示A中的一个元素(单位或者人)和B中的一个号码。那么所有这些有关的序对(a,b)就构成电话号码本,就构成这个号码集合。可以看出这个集合正好是A与B的笛卡尔积Atimes;B的一个子集。当有人或有单位的号码发生变化,这个号码本也相应地发生变化,变成另外一个号码本,也就是另外一个集合,另外一个子集合,但仍然是Atimes;B的一个子集。  【例3】(学生、课程、成绩之间的关系)假设用集合A表示某大学计算机学院的所有学生,B集合表示计算机学院的所有课程,C集合表示不大于100的非负整数的集合,那么学生张三的离散数学考试成绩是95分,就可以表示成(张三,离散数学,95)。将计算机学院所有学生所有课程的这样的记录放在一起,就是一张成绩表,也就是教务管理中的成绩库。那么这个成绩库就是一个集合,这个集合表示的是计算机学院学生,课程和成绩三者之间的一个关系。而这个集合恰好是集合A、B、C的笛卡尔积Atimes;Btimes;C的一个子集。 毕业论文  以上三个例子都说明了同一个问题:无论是一个集合内部元素之间的关系,还是不同集合的元素之间的关系,还是多个集合元素之间的关系,都可以表示成相关集合的笛卡尔积的子集。把笛卡尔积的子集当成一个数学模型,那就可以用这个数学模型来表示关系,包括二元关系和多元关系[4]。  3 抽象关系的具体解释  设集合A={a,b,c,d},S={(a,b),(c,d)},显然,那么根据定义1,S是A

文档评论(0)

docman126 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

版权声明书
用户编号:7042123103000003

1亿VIP精品文档

相关文档